1998-S Half Dollars Kennedy PCGS PR-69 DCAM

The 1998 S Half Dollars Kennedy PCGS PR-69 DCAM is a stunning numismatic coin from the United States, offering a unique blend of historical significance and exceptional quality. This proof coin, graded by the Professional Coin Grading Service (PCGS) as PR-69 Deep Cameo (DCAM), is a true testament to the exceptional craftsmanship and attention to detail that has defined the Kennedy half dollar series since its inception.

The Kennedy half dollar, first minted in 1964, was introduced to commemorate the life and legacy of President John F. Kennedy, who was tragically assassinated in 1963. The coin's design, featuring a portrait of the beloved president on the obverse and the presidential seal on the reverse, has become an iconic symbol of American history and heritage.

This particular 1998 S Kennedy half dollar, struck at the San Francisco Mint, boasts a deep, reflective proof finish that creates a stunning contrast with the frosted devices. The PCGS PR-69 DCAM grade indicates that the coin is in near-perfect condition, with only the slightest of imperfections visible under close inspection.
